Hi, you are doing a real good job. Quick loading pages & easy to navigate. The only thing that stands out for me on the looks side is the BV logo banner might look better blended in with the template colours or the buttons?
The page template has also been stretched a bit to much & has created some distortion in the image. (But only slight).
On the SE side of your pages, you have to may key words. (I believe about 20 should be max) Also any of the key words should also be within the text of the page that they relate to. Also it’s nice to have Peace of Mind Home Inspection Service as a key word, but would some one type this in as a search? Maybe just “home inspection service” or “building inspection”. This may apply to the page title as well.
As an example, your “about the inspection” page could have better words within the page & then include these in the key words area.

It will give something for the SE’s to find, Especially if you put <h1> tags around the page header that might be called “About the building inspection” Then <h2> tags around the heading of each topic.
